    EastEnders icon Shaun Williamson has shed light on his relationship with his secret son, who revealed he loved the show before finding out his father’s identity. 

    Speaking to The Sun On Sunday, the father-son duo admitted they were making up for lost time after it was revealed in September that Shaun had fathered the child with a circus juggler more than 30 years ago. 

    The star, 55, who played Barry Evans in the soap, said: ‘I know I’ve missed out on a lot of his life — now I can make up for it’, while Gary revealed he had been misled over the identity of his father until recently.

    Shaun, who has a daughter Sophie, 22, and son Joseph, 20 with ex-wife Melanie Sacre, gushed over his delight at forging a bond with Gary. 

    Gary said: ‘My nan used to tell me I loved EastEnders as a boy. One of my favourites was Barry. Nan always told me his storylines had me hooked and made me laugh…

    ‘For years I thought someone else was my dad, but some information from my mum and a paternity test revealed that it was in fact the bloke I used to watch on the TV all those years ago…

    ‘I tell people I meet that ‘Barry from ­EastEnders is my dad’ — they never believe me, but it’s true. The guy I thought was my father left when I was six, but to now have the relationship I do with Shaun is a dream. It’s proof that miracles do happen.’

    Gary went as far as revealing that he had once attempted to meet Shaun at a meet and greet however he had not managed to reach out. 

    Shaun, who lives on The Isle of Sheppey, confessed he was concerned for his other kids, as he said: ‘My first concern was that my other adult kids Sophie and Joe were OK. But they were absolutely great with it.’

    Last year, Shaun detailed how he received an email in 2013 from Gary living in Northern Ireland who claimed to be his son. He told how the revelation was ‘the most frightening but amazing discovery’.

    Speaking to The Sun on Sunday, Shaun said: ‘When I found out I had another son, I was stunned. I was shaking when I went to meet him.’   

    The actor added: ‘He said he never thought in a million years that Barry from EastEnders could be his dad.’

    The Celebrity Big Brother star told how he met Gary’s mother, who remains anonymous, when he was working as a barman in 1987 aged 22.

    Shaun described how he was ‘blown away’ by the circus juggler and the pair went onto get engaged after six months despite having a ‘fiery relationship’.

    The star ended the relationship as he took up a job as a Pontin’s Bluecoat before he was told by his ex-fianceé that she was pregnant. 

    However she later explained to her ex Shaun that her landlord’s son was in fact the father and his name would be on the birth certificate.

    In 2013 the former postman received an email out-of-the-blue stating it was ‘Gary’ from his ‘circus days’.  

    The Extras star sent a paternity test to a centre in Canada which confirmed that he was his biological son with Shaun describing how it all ‘fell into place’. 

    Shaun met his long-lost son Gary in a hotel in Belfast and described how the pair ‘hit it off’ from the start.

    He said: ‘It was a surreal experience. I could immediately see the similarity. We hit it off straight away.’ 

    Shaun became a household name thanks to his role as Barry Evans on EastEnders from 1994 until 2004. His character was dramatically killed off by the evil Janine Butcher (Charlie Brooks).

    The actor has gone on to appear on the likes of current programme Mister Winner, Ricky Gervais’ Extras and Scoop. 

    While in 2017, he appeared on Celebrity Big Brother and joked as he entered the house that he would have ‘Barry from EastEnders’ written on his gravestone.
